What Quebec adds for a instalment loan in Gatineau
A lender dealing with a Gatineau resident holds a licence issued under Quebec consumer credit law, and that licence is the first thing a borrower can check.
For reference in Gatineau, the recorded Quebec position on payday lending reads as follows: Quebec does not license payday lending, which effectively prohibits the model in the province. No provincial payday cap is published; confirm the position with the provincial regulator.

Population and land area for Gatineau
Gatineau recorded a population of 291,041 in Statistics Canada's 2021 Census of Population. 341.8 square kilometres of land are attributed to Gatineau in the census.
That produces a density of 851.4 people per square kilometre in Gatineau.
Gatineau is the 4th largest covered place in Quebec.
